Addressing Poverty Through Governance and Community
This chapter explores the complexities of U.S. government programs designed to alleviate poverty, emphasizing their historical successes despite common skepticism. It advocates for a collective vision of economic security and encourages individuals to become 'poverty abolitionists' by taking actionable steps towards improvement. The discussion highlights the balance between self-interest and communal responsibility, urging a reframing of societal attitudes towards poverty and support initiatives.
